Brimley has an obesity rate of 35.8%, which is near the national average. The depression rate is 26.6%, 3.1pp above the national average. About 6.0% of adults lack health insurance. 83.1% of residents had an annual checkup in the past year. There is 1 hospital nearby. 1 offers emergency services.
